  • the invention relates to a fence column and a fence system for a safety fence, in particular to an anti-climbing fence column and a fence system.
  • the protective fence in the prior art generally includes a plurality of fence posts, a plurality of fence pieces installed between adjacent pairs of fence posts, and the fence pieces are fixed between the pair of fence posts by fasteners or locking structures.
  • the fence column usually consists of a column, a cover plate and a fastener.
  • the column of the fence column plays a main supporting role.
  • the column body can adopt a structure with a rectangular cross section, a trapezoidal shape, a work shape or a U shape, such as EP1564351B1.
  • the cover and the dense mesh are tightly combined, the ends of the fasteners are generally smooth and close to the surface of the cover, so that it is not easy to climb; and the rear of the protective fence, the entire body is exposed, for The end of the fixing cover and the fastener of the main body are exposed outside the cylinder. If climbing from the rear side of the protective fence, the protruding end of the fastener can be used as a force point, and the cylinder can be grasped and climbed easily. Prisons and other places need special attention to prevent people from escaping from inside the fence. Therefore, the protective fence should be able to effectively prevent climbing in both directions.
  • the column with a rectangular cross section is easy to be gripped by the intruder due to the uniform width of the front and rear, so the anti-climbing effect is not good;
  • the column structure with a U-shaped cross section because the rear wall surface of the cylinder protrudes, Therefore, it is easy for an intruder to completely hold the fence column and apply force to climb, so the anti-climbing effect is not good.

  • the invention has a groove formed on the rear wall surface of the cylinder body, so that the ends of the fastener are all received in the groove, thereby reducing the protrusion on the back side of the fence column and reducing the climbing force point, so it is not easy to climb. climb;
  • the groove structure can be increased, the strength of the column can be increased, and the length of the fastener connection can be shortened, so that shorter fasteners can be used for fixing, saving cost;
  • the rear portions of the pair of side wall surfaces of the present invention gradually close together.
  • the contact area between the hand and the cylinder is small, the friction is small, and the hand is not easy to apply force, especially the column.
  • the rear portion of the body is formed with a groove, which further reduces the contact area between the rear wall surface of the column and the hand, so that the column body is not easy to climb.

  • the fence system is usually installed around the building or the enclosure as shown in Figures 2 and 9. The front portion of the column 110 is outward and the rear is inward.
  • the method of the present invention is such that the rear wall surface 113 has a portion on the side where the front wall surface is recessed to form a groove 115, and the remaining portion of the rear wall surface 113 forms the pillar 110.
  • the rear end portion of the fastener 300 is substantially flush with the groove of the groove 115, or the rear end portion of the fastener 300 is located in the groove 115, that is, The rear end portion of the fastener 300 does not exceed or slightly exceed the notch of the groove 115, so that the rear end surface of the fence post 100 is flat and has no protrusions, and it is difficult for the climber to find the climbing point, thereby Plays a role of anti-climbing; of course, the rear end of the fastener 300 does not exceed or slightly exceed the notch of the groove 115 is a most preferred way to ensure that the climber cannot focus on the fastener In the case of the end, the rear section of the fastener 300 allows a portion to extend out of the notch of the groove 115.
  • the fastener 300 includes a bolt 301 and a nut 302.
  • the bolt 301 passes through the cover 120 and the cylinder 110 in sequence, and is then tightened by a nut 302 located in the recess 115, and the nut 302 is abutted.
  • the bottom of the groove of the groove 115 ensures the stable compression between the cover 120 and the column 110, thereby ensuring that the fence piece 200 is pressed and fixed, so as to ensure the rigidity of the nut 302 at the groove bottom of the groove 115. Force, designed to make the bottom of the groove flat.
  • the cross section of the cylinder 110 is preferably formed in the circumferential direction. A closed week, so that the climber's hand can't reach into the fence or the column, so it is not easy to apply force and climb.
  • the front wall surface 112 of the cylinder 110 opposite to the cover 120 may also have an opening, and the cover 120 and the fence body 200 block the opening, and the remaining sides of the cylinder 110 form a circumferentially continuous outer peripheral surface.
  • a pair of the side wall surfaces 114 are disposed between the front wall surface 112 and the rear wall surface 113, and the rear portions of the pair of the side wall surfaces 114 are gradually approached from the front to the rear, so that when held by the hand
  • the cylinder 110 is biased, since the rear portions of the pair of the side wall surfaces 114 are gradually close together, the contact area between the cylinder 110 and the hand is small, and it is difficult to grasp and apply force to prevent climbing. effect.
  • the width of the notch of the groove 115 is greater than the width of the groove bottom. Since the cylinder 110 is usually formed by bending a steel plate, the sides of the groove 115 are inclined to increase the strength of the cylinder 110.
  • the groove 115 has a notch width of 50 mm or less, which prevents the foot from protruding into the groove 115.

Abstract

L'invention concerne un poteau de clôture et un système de clôture, le poteau de clôture comprenant un corps de poteau (110) s'étendant longitudinalement et comportant une surface de paroi avant (112) raccordée à un corps lamellaire (200) de clôture, un élément de fixation (300) raccordé sur le corps de poteau (110), une surface de paroi arrière (113) correspondant à la surface latérale avant (112) et une surface de paroi latérale (114) venant entre les surfaces de paroi (112, 113) avant et arrière. L'orientation de la partie d'extrémité avant de l'élément de fixation (300) est reliée au corps lamellaire (200) de clôture et à la surface de paroi avant (112) du corps de poteau (110), sa partie d'extrémité arrière traversant le corps lamellaire (200) de clôture et le corps de poteau (110) tout en étant fixée sur la surface de paroi arrière (113) du corps de poteau (110). Cette surface de paroi arrière (113) présente en partie une rainure concave (115) formée par évidement sur la surface de paroi avant (112) , la partie d'extrémité arrière de l'élément de fixation (300) étant logée dans la rainure concave (115) sans dépasser l'encoche ménagée sur la rainure concave (115). Ce poteau de clôture et ce système de clôture permettent de réduire les protubérances du côté arrière du poteau de clôture, rendant ainsi difficile toute tentative de montée. De plus, les instruments préviennent tout endommagement causé par l'insertion dans la rainure, la résistance du corps de poteau peut être renforcée et les coûts de fixation réduits.
